About us

Our Mission Aloha United Way brings resources, organizations and people together to advance the health, education and financial stability of every person in our community. Our Roots Aloha United Way was originally established by Frank C. Atherton as the United Welfare Fund, under the Chamber of Commerce, in 1919 to create a more efficient way of distributing charitable giving. As Hawaii has changed and evolved over the last 100 years, so has our mission and work.

    Great way to tell the ALICE story - 3 maps - by Noah Sheidlower and Juliana Kaplan in Business Insider. Looking at the change in income status from 2010 to 2021, the maps show poverty has not changed much and the number of wealthier families (Above ALICE Threshold) has mostly decreased (except states with influx during the pandemic). But ALICE - Asset Limited, Income Constrained, Employed - households that have increased! This group that hasn't even had a name until now, but has been the fastest growing. #UnitedForALICE https://lnkd.in/e4fUcuDe
